telnet连接.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
telnet连接.doc

telnet连接 步骤 .telnet.TelnetClient 1 new 一个TelnetClient 赋值ip地址,port,超时时间 TelnetClient tc=new TelnetClient(); 2读取telnet输入流, tc.setDefaultTimeout(10000); tc.connect(1, 23); 3用inputstream和outputstream控制输入输出进行交互 InputStream in=tc.getInputStream(); OutputStream out=tc.getOutputStream(); 例子 TelnetClient tc=new TelnetClient(); try { tc.setDefaultTimeout(10000); tc.connect(1, 23); InputStream in=tc.getInputStream(); OutputStream out=tc.getOutputStream(); BufferedReader sin=new BufferedReader(new InputStreamReader(System.in)); byte[] bs=new byte[256]; int i=0; while((i=in.read(bs))-1){ String str=null; if(i==256){ str=new String(bs); }else{ byte[] bs2=new byte[i]; for(int j=0;ji;j++) { bs2[j]=bs[j]; } str=new String(bs2); } System.out.println(str); String commond=null; if(str.indexOf(ogin:)-1||str.indexOf(assword:)-1){ commond = sin.readLine(); out.write((commond+\n).getBytes()); out.flush(); }else{ //out.write(( \n).getBytes()); } } } catch (SocketException e) { // TODO Auto-generated catch block e.printStackTrace(); } catch (IOException e) { // TODO Auto-generated catch block e.printStackTrace(); } ftp连接 .ftp.FTPClient; 步骤: 1建立连接 FTPClient ftp = new FTPClient(); ftp.connect(1, 21); ftp.login(itcc, itcc) 2对目录里的文件进行修改,(上传,删除,重命名等) 主要方法 Rename(Stirng,String) Connect(String host,int port) Login(username,password) stroeFile系列 代码 FTPClient ftp = new FTPClient(); try { ftp.connect(1, 21); if (!ftp.login(itcc, itcc)) { System.out.println(Ftp登陆失败); }else{ ftp.setFileType(.ftp.FTP.IMAGE_FILE_TYPE); ftp.storeUniqueFile(1.jpg,new FileInputStream(D:/1.jpg)); } if(ftp != null ftp.isConnected()) try { ftp.disconnect(); } catch (IOException e) { } } catch (SocketException e) { // TODO Auto-generated catch block e.printStackTrace(); } catch (I

文档评论(0)

gsgtshb +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档